product

Definition

  • noun: something that is made or grown to be sold or used
  • noun: the number or expression resulting from the multiplication together of two or more numbers or expressions
  • often used before another noun
  • synonyms: work, result, fruit

Examples

  • My grandfather was a 'product of' his times. [=my grandfather was like other people who grew up with him]

  • The loss of jobs was an unfortunate 'by-product of' the industry's switch to new technology.

  • ('technical') The company needs to find a way to sell more 'product'.
